England defends 129 runs to sweep Sri Lanka series 3-0

England defends 129 runs to sweep Sri Lanka series 3-0

England completed a 3-0 T20 series sweep against Sri Lanka after defending a modest 129 runs in Pallekele. Sam Curran rescued England with a career-best 58, despite Dushmantha Chameera's 5-24 haul. Sri Lanka collapsed from 90-4 to 116 all out as spinners Jacob Bethell and Will Jacks claimed seven wickets combined. Bethell finished with 4-11, securing England's lowest-ever successfully defended T20 total ahead of the World Cup.
